Laurent-Desire Kabila
1939 – 2001 Congolese Rebel leader, President of the Democratic Republic of the Congo
Rebel who toppled Mobutu and became president before being assassinated.
- Affiliations
- AFDL, earlier Lumumbist rebel movements
Laurent-Desire Kabila fought as a Lumumbist rebel in the 1960s, then led the Rwandan- and Ugandan-backed AFDL coalition that overthrew Mobutu in 1997. He renamed the country the Democratic Republic of the Congo and soon fell out with his former backers, helping ignite the Second Congo War. He was assassinated by a bodyguard in 2001 and succeeded by his son Joseph.
